Work Continues On £1.7m East Ayrshire Housing Development

Construction News Image
CCG is continuing work on a £1.7 million housing development in East Ayrshire.

A total of 11 new 'affordable' homes are being developed at Barbieston Road in Dalrymple. Five homes are now complete and work is on schedule for completion this autumn.

Once finished, the scheme will consist of eight two-bedroom homes, two two-bedroom homes specially designed for older people and one two-bedroom home designed for wheelchair users.

Council Leader Douglas Reid recently visited the site with Councillor Elena Whitham, Cabinet Member for Housing and Communities and local members for Doon Valley, Councillors John Bell, Elaine Dinwoodie and Drew Filson.

Cllr Reid said: "The Barbieston Road housing development is being built on the site of the former community centre and library which have been relocated to new, modern facilities within Dalrymple Primary School. The homes have been designed to a very high standard, will be built using modern methods of construction and will be energy efficient.

"I was delighted to visit the site and will be keeping up to date with progress throughout the build. This development is sure to help make Dalrymple clean, green and vibrant once again."

Calum Murray, Director at CCG (Scotland), said: "Over the past two years, we have worked on several contracts for East Ayrshire Council including the conversion of the Ingram Enterprise Centre on John Finnie Street, Kilmarnock, a tenement development that was reconfigured to high-spec office space, as well as the structural upgrade of seven properties in Hearth Place, Cumnock.

"The latest development at Barbieston Road is a landmark project that launches a strategic partnership that will help deliver up to 400 homes in East Ayrshire over the next four years. Our capabilities in construction, utilising our expertise in offsite manufacturing, will ensure that the new homes are delivered quickly and to the highest quality and environmental efficiency standards."
